Water ice is strongly implicated as the major component of polar mesospheric clouds (PMC), noctilucent clouds (NLC) and probably polar mesospheric summer echo (PMSE) layers. Hervig et al [2001] have recently shown the infrared spectral signature of water ice in HALOE solar occultation observations in suspected PMC layers. We have taken a complementary approach by asking whether there is other evidence that ice can form in these locations. We have used 10-years of UARS-HALOE temperature and water vapor data in order to investigate whether ice saturation occurs routinely at the summer, high latitude mesopause. The data reveal that regions of ice saturation as well as supersaturation occur precisely where satellite observations of PMC tend to occur. The HALOE data predict the PMC distribution in latitude, altitude, and day of the year. There is even a rough correspondence between the occurrence frequency of PMC at a particular day and location with the percentage of the time that ice supersaturation is calculated to occur there. This appears to be the first time that such comparisons have been made for a near-global data set, including both northern and southern hemispheres.
